If you are utilizing criticism, contempt, stonewalling and defensiveness; you're not going to have the connection, the trust, the sense of belonging that you need to heal wounded relationships. This episode is about having difficult conversations. Mason and Sarah always bring us important lessons, but still filled with laughter and love.
